Psalm 8:1~9
Psalm 8:1 O Lord, our Lord, how excellent is thy name in all the earth! who hast set thy glory above the heavens. 37 I MC VC
Psalm 8:2 Out of the mouth of babes and sucklings hast thou ordained strength because of thine enemies, that thou mightest still the enemy and the avenger. MC VC
Psalm 8:3 When I consider thy heavens, the work of thy fingers, the moon and the stars, which thou hast ordained; 8 I MC VC
Psalm 8:4 What is man, that thou art mindful of him? and the son of man, that thou visitest him? 14 I MC VC
Psalm 8:5 For thou hast made him a little lower than the angels, and hast crowned him with glory and honour. 2 I MC VC
Psalm 8:6 Thou madest him to have dominion over the works of thy hands; thou hast put all things under his feet: 4 I MC VC
Psalm 8:7 All sheep and oxen, yea, and the beasts of the field; 2 I MC VC
Psalm 8:8 The fowl of the air, and the fish of the sea, and whatsoever passeth through the paths of the seas. 2 I MC VC
Psalm 8:9 O Lord our Lord, how excellent is thy name in all the earth! 30 I MC VC
Psalm 81:1~16
Psalm 81:1 Sing aloud unto God our strength: make a joyful noise unto the God of Jacob. 4 I MC VC
Psalm 81:2 Take a psalm, and bring hither the timbrel, the pleasant harp with the psaltery. MC VC
Psalm 81:3 Blow up the trumpet in the new moon, in the time appointed, on our solemn feast day. MC VC
Psalm 81:4 For this was a statute for Israel, and a law of the God of Jacob. MC VC
Psalm 81:5 This he ordained in Joseph for a testimony, when he went out through the land of Egypt: where I heard a language that I understood not. MC VC
Psalm 81:6 I removed his shoulder from the burden: his hands were delivered from the pots. MC VC
Psalm 81:7 Thou calledst in trouble, and I delivered thee; I answered thee in the secret place of thunder: I proved thee at the waters of Meribah. Selah. MC VC
Psalm 81:8 Hear, O my people, and I will testify unto thee: O Israel, if thou wilt hearken unto me; 4 I MC VC
Psalm 81:9 There shall no strange god be in thee; neither shalt thou worship any strange god. 4 I MC VC
Psalm 81:10 I am the Lord thy God, which brought thee out of the land of Egypt: open thy mouth wide, and I will fill it. 11 I MC VC
Psalm 81:11 But my people would not hearken to my voice; and Israel would none of me. 6 I MC VC
Psalm 81:12 So I gave them up unto their own hearts’ lust: and they walked in their own counsels. MC VC
Psalm 81:13 Oh that my people had hearkened unto me, and Israel had walked in my ways! 2 I MC VC
Psalm 81:14 I should soon have subdued their enemies, and turned my hand against their adversaries. MC VC
Psalm 81:15 The haters of the Lord should have submitted themselves unto him: but their time should have endured for ever. 4 I MC VC
Psalm 81:16 He should have fed them also with the finest of the wheat: and with honey out of the rock should I have satisfied thee. 6 I MC VC
Psalm 84:1~12
Psalm 84:1 How amiable are thy tabernacles, O Lord of hosts! 36 I MC VC
Psalm 84:2 My soul longeth, yea, even fainteth for the courts of the Lord: my heart and my flesh crieth out for the living God. 10 I MC VC
Psalm 84:3 Yea, the sparrow hath found an house, and the swallow a nest for herself, where she may lay her young, even thine altars, O Lord of hosts, my King, and my God. 4 I MC VC
Psalm 84:4 Blessed are they that dwell in thy house: they will be still praising thee. Selah. 16 I MC VC
Psalm 84:5 Blessed is the man whose strength is in thee; in whose heart are the ways of them. 11 I MC VC
Psalm 84:6 Who passing through the valley of Baca make it a well; the rain also filleth the pools. MC VC
Psalm 84:7 They go from strength to strength, every one of them in Zion appeareth before God. MC VC
Psalm 84:8 O Lord God of hosts, hear my prayer: give ear, O God of Jacob. Selah. 2 I MC VC
Psalm 84:9 Behold, O God our shield, and look upon the face of thine anointed. MC VC
Psalm 84:10 For a day in thy courts is better than a thousand. I had rather be a doorkeeper in the house of my God, than to dwell in the tents of wickedness. 6 I MC VC
Psalm 84:11 For the Lord God is a sun and shield: the Lord will give grace and glory: no good thing will he withhold from them that walk uprightly. 7 I MC VC
Psalm 84:12 O Lord of hosts, blessed is the man that trusteth in thee. 13 I MC VC
